How to use the LDAC function of the Earbuds?

LDAC high-definition audio can be understood as a "highway" between a mobile phone and Earbuds. It supports a 24-bit bit depth, a 96kHz sampling rate, and a streaming transmission rate of 990kbps. The high transmission bit rate prevents high-resolution audio files from being over-compressed, thus preserving more musical details and significantly improving sound quality.
*This high-definition audio will only take effect if the mobile phone supports it and the selected codec has been enabled on the phone.

For Android phones, first check if your phone has LDAC enabled by default. If not, go to [Settings - Developer Options] to see if LDAC is supported. If your phone supports LDAC, enable it first. Then connect your Earbuds to the Nothing X App, tap Device settings in the App, and then turn on High-quality audio to enable the LDAC high-definition audio codec.
*To ensure the smooth playback of LDAC high-definition audio, it is recommended that when using this feature: 1) In the phone's Developer Options, set the LDAC playback quality to the default adaptive mode; 2) If a higher-quality audio bitstream is selected on the phone, it is recommended to turn off the dual-connection feature to ensure that the LDAC high-definition bitstream has sufficient bandwidth for use.
*Since iOS devices only support the AAC Bluetooth high-quality audio codec, they are temporarily unable to support other high-quality audio codecs.
